Migrating From Elasticsearch 7.17 to Elasticsearch 8.x: Pitfalls and Learnings
Great post from Zalando and a reminder that users of your software only update in case of features or bug fixes affecting them. One of the reasons why pushing out features is so important. Otherwise you will be supporting certain versions for eternity - I mean you will anyway.
I like the Testcontainers strategy to ensure existing applications work with the old and new Elasticsearch versions.
https://engineering.zalando.com/posts/2023/11/migrating-from-elasticsearch-7-to-8-learnings.html
